Transaction 758ea2cdc5cc6fd07147aefe85634a35dcdb2ffb331b2861b006a180074aa0a2

153 Input
2 Outputs
  • 758ea2cdc5cc6fd07147aefe85634a35dcdb2ffb331b2861b006a180074aa0a2:0
  • value  114833
    address  bc1qtksxtjdqx4kz3ap8zyeu0ktl68x63759k9dntn8t6dcc7x0zsw3qy3l4fu
  • 758ea2cdc5cc6fd07147aefe85634a35dcdb2ffb331b2861b006a180074aa0a2:1
  • value  37026000
    address  31judFUXJsot5kybcvJ3m9gBDyuhPGqokS